13 Morgan Dr sits in South Natick, near Main Street and Highland Street. The building is close to Farm Pond, which adds a nice touch to the area. This low-rise structure was built in 2013 and has only 1 story. It includes 19 condominium units, offering a blend of 1 and 2 bedrooms. Unit sizes range from 920 to 1,705 square feet. Prices for these units range from $629,000 to $720,000. The lowest sold price in the past year is about $665,000. The average closed price stands at $710,000, with an average price per square foot of $496. Units generally spend around 70 days on the market. The building offers useful amenities for residents. Enjoy access to a golf course, playground, and nearby bike paths. Public transportation and highway access are also close, which is helpful for commuting. For outdoor enjoyment, parks and tennis courts are nearby, allowing for active lifestyles. The design of the building includes reliable features. Each unit has an open floor plan that enhances living space. Many units come with private balconies. There is a heated garage that can be reached by elevator, along with ample parking outside. The community is pet friendly, making it accommodating for pet owners. Local amenities include restaurants and schools. Mugsy Mugs offers dining not far from home. Natick Town High School and Backstage Dance Center are also nearby, serving the community’s educational needs. This building strikes a balance between comfort and connection to local resources.
